Deciding on the Ideal Home Battery Solution
When choosing a home battery emergency power supply, it is important to think about your specific energy needs. Begin by evaluating the appliances and devices you want to supply electricity to during an interruption. Estimate zonnepanelen met accu for each device, and ensure the battery system you select can accommodate the total load. This assessment will assist you identify the capacity and performance level required from your emergency power supply.
Afterward, think about battery chemistry and type. Home battery systems commonly use Li-ion or lead-acid technology. Li-ion batteries are more efficient, have a longer lifespan, and demand less maintenance compared to their lead-acid counterparts. However, lead-acid batteries could come at a reduced initial cost. Understanding the differences will assist in making an educated choice based on both budget and long-term efficiency.

Setup and Care Tips
When configuring your home battery emergency power supply, make sure that you pick a site that is dry, not hot, and well-ventilated. This will help preserve the efficiency of the battery and stop overheating. Adhere to the manufacturer’s instructions carefully, connecting the battery to your home’s electrical system as recommended. If you’re uncertain about the process, it’s prudent to hire a professional to ensure everything is set up correctly.
Routine maintenance of your battery backup system is crucial for optimal performance. Check the battery’s charge level regularly and observe its overall health. Most batteries are typically replaced every five to ten years, contingent upon usage and the quality of the unit. Make certain to follow any care instructions from the manufacturer, such as wiping down terminals and connectors to prevent corrosion.
In addition to maintenance checks, consider checking your backup system each month. This involves unplugging the primary power supply and ensuring that the battery turns on as planned. If you face any issues during testing, address them immediately to ensure your home power supply remains reliable during emergencies.
